Kia Syros SUV Variants Explained - Features, Trims, and Specifications

The Kia Syros is an exciting new entrant in the Indian SUV market, fitting between the Sonet and Seltos while offering a wide range of features across its six trim levels.

Here's a detailed breakdown of the variants:

HTK

Base model with essential features:

  • Exterior: Halogen headlamps, 15-inch steel wheels, shark fin antenna, integrated spoiler.

  • Interior: Black & grey dual-tone with matte orange accents, semi-leatherette seats, 4.2-inch TFT MID, 12.3-inch touchscreen with wireless Android Auto/Apple CarPlay.

  • Comfort & Convenience: Electric power steering, manual AC, rear AC vents, power windows, rear sunshade curtains.

  • Safety: 6 airbags, ABS, ESC, HAC, VSM, front/rear parking sensors, ISOFIX.

HTK (O)

Adds more comfort and design upgrades:

  • New Features: Electric sunroof, LED map lamp, roof rails, electric ORVMs with autofold, 16-inch crystal-cut alloys (diesel only), height-adjustable driver seat.

HTK+

Enhanced premium features for convenience:

  • Exterior: Dual-pane panoramic sunroof, puddle lamps.

  • Interior: Cloud blue & grey dual-tone with mint green accents, 60:40 split rear seats with recline.

  • Driving: Paddle shifters, cruise control (petrol only), rear disc brakes, drive/traction modes (petrol only).

  • Convenience: Smart key with push-button start, rear armrest with cup holders, driver auto up/down window with safety.

HTX

Focuses on style and functionality:

  • Exterior: LED headlamps, Starmap LED DRLs, and tail lamps.

  • Interior: Leatherette seats, ventilated front seats, adjustable rear headrests.

  • Additional Features: Luggage lamp, all-door auto up/down windows, drive/traction modes (petrol only).

HTX+

High-tech and luxury upgrades:

  • Technology: 12.3-inch HD instrument cluster and touchscreen, Harman Kardon 8-speaker sound system, OTA updates, 64-color ambient lighting.

  • Convenience: Wireless smartphone charger, 4-way power driver seat, rear ventilated seats, auto anti-glare rearview mirror.

  • Premium Features: 17-inch crystal-cut alloys, sporty alloy pedals, Kia Connect 2.0, smart air purifier.

HTX+ (O)

Flagship variant with advanced safety and tech:

  • ADAS Features: Level 2 autonomous safety with front collision avoidance, smart cruise control, lane keep/follow assist, 360-degree camera, blind-view monitor.

  • Additional Safety: Side parking sensors, parking collision avoidance assist.

Key Takeaways

The HTK variant is perfect for budget-conscious buyers, while the HTX+ (O) is for those seeking advanced technology and luxury. With a focus on safety, connectivity, and comfort, the Kia Syros caters to a broad spectrum of customers.
